Safe Haskell | Safe-Infered |
---|
Documentation
newGtkBuffer :: Maybe FilePath -> String -> IDEM EditorBufferSource
newYiBuffer :: Maybe FilePath -> String -> IDEM EditorBufferSource
applyTagByName :: EditorBuffer -> String -> EditorIter -> EditorIter -> IDEM ()Source
canRedo :: EditorBuffer -> IDEM BoolSource
canUndo :: EditorBuffer -> IDEM BoolSource
copyClipboard :: EditorBuffer -> Clipboard -> IDEM ()Source
createMark :: EditorBuffer -> EditorIter -> Bool -> IDEM EditorMarkSource
cutClipboard :: EditorBuffer -> Clipboard -> Bool -> IDEM ()Source
delete :: EditorBuffer -> EditorIter -> EditorIter -> IDEM ()Source
deleteSelection :: EditorBuffer -> Bool -> Bool -> IDEM ()Source
getIterAtLine :: EditorBuffer -> Int -> IDEM EditorIterSource
getIterAtOffset :: EditorBuffer -> Int -> IDEM EditorIterSource
getSlice :: EditorBuffer -> EditorIter -> EditorIter -> Bool -> IDEM StringSource
getText :: EditorBuffer -> EditorIter -> EditorIter -> Bool -> IDEM StringSource
insert :: EditorBuffer -> EditorIter -> String -> IDEM ()Source
moveMark :: EditorBuffer -> EditorMark -> EditorIter -> IDEM ()Source
newView :: EditorBuffer -> Maybe String -> IDEM EditorViewSource
pasteClipboard :: EditorBuffer -> Clipboard -> EditorIter -> Bool -> IDEM ()Source
placeCursor :: EditorBuffer -> EditorIter -> IDEM ()Source
redo :: EditorBuffer -> IDEM ()Source
removeTagByName :: EditorBuffer -> String -> EditorIter -> EditorIter -> IDEM ()Source
selectRange :: EditorBuffer -> EditorIter -> EditorIter -> IDEM ()Source
setModified :: EditorBuffer -> Bool -> IDEM ()Source
undo :: EditorBuffer -> IDEM ()Source
bufferToWindowCoords :: EditorView -> (Int, Int) -> IDEM (Int, Int)Source
drawTabs :: EditorView -> IDEM ()Source
getOverwrite :: EditorView -> IDEM BoolSource
grabFocus :: EditorView -> IDEM ()Source
scrollToMark :: EditorView -> EditorMark -> Double -> Maybe (Double, Double) -> IDEM ()Source
scrollToIter :: EditorView -> EditorIter -> Double -> Maybe (Double, Double) -> IDEM ()Source
setIndentWidth :: EditorView -> Int -> IDEM ()Source
setWrapMode :: EditorView -> Bool -> IDEM ()Source
setRightMargin :: EditorView -> Maybe Int -> IDEM ()Source
setShowLineNumbers :: EditorView -> Bool -> IDEM ()Source
setTabWidth :: EditorView -> Int -> IDEM ()Source
backwardFindCharC :: EditorIter -> (Char -> Bool) -> Maybe EditorIter -> IDEM (Maybe EditorIter)Source
endsWord :: EditorIter -> IDEM BoolSource
forwardCharsC :: EditorIter -> Int -> IDEM EditorIterSource
forwardFindCharC :: EditorIter -> (Char -> Bool) -> Maybe EditorIter -> IDEM (Maybe EditorIter)Source
forwardSearch :: EditorIter -> String -> [TextSearchFlags] -> Maybe EditorIter -> IDEM (Maybe (EditorIter, EditorIter))Source
getLine :: EditorIter -> IDEM IntSource
getLineOffset :: EditorIter -> IDEM IntSource
getOffset :: EditorIter -> IDEM IntSource
isStart :: EditorIter -> IDEM BoolSource
isEnd :: EditorIter -> IDEM BoolSource
iterEqual :: EditorIter -> EditorIter -> IDEM BoolSource
startsLine :: EditorIter -> IDEM BoolSource
atEnd :: EditorIter -> IDEM EditorIterSource
atLine :: EditorIter -> Int -> IDEM EditorIterSource
atLineOffset :: EditorIter -> Int -> IDEM EditorIterSource
atOffset :: EditorIter -> Int -> IDEM EditorIterSource
afterFocusIn :: EditorView -> IDEM () -> IDEM [Connection]Source
afterModifiedChanged :: EditorBuffer -> IDEM () -> IDEM [Connection]Source
afterMoveCursor :: EditorView -> IDEM () -> IDEM [Connection]Source
afterToggleOverwrite :: EditorView -> IDEM () -> IDEM [Connection]Source
onButtonPress :: EditorView -> (Event -> IDEM Bool) -> IDEM [Connection]Source
onButtonRelease :: EditorView -> (Event -> IDEM Bool) -> IDEM [Connection]Source
onCompletion :: EditorView -> IDEM () -> IDEM () -> IDEM [Connection]Source
onKeyPress :: EditorView -> (String -> [Modifier] -> KeyVal -> IDEM Bool) -> IDEM [Connection]Source
onKeyRelease :: EditorView -> (String -> [Modifier] -> KeyVal -> IDEM Bool) -> IDEM [Connection]Source
onLookupInfo :: EditorView -> IDEM () -> IDEM [Connection]Source
onMotionNotify :: EditorView -> (Double -> Double -> [Modifier] -> IDEM Bool) -> IDEM [Connection]Source
onLeaveNotify :: EditorView -> IDEM Bool -> IDEM [Connection]Source
onPopulatePopup :: EditorView -> (Menu -> IDEM ()) -> IDEM [Connection]Source